The Easton Catcher’s Wheeled Bag in Black is a serious piece of gear for any baseball or softball catcher. It’s built tough to handle the demands of the game, from practices to championship tournaments. This bag makes getting your equipment to and from the field a breeze.
What We Like:
- It has a strong, rigid bottom and back. This keeps your gear safe.
- The telescopic handle pulls out easily. It makes rolling the bag simple.
- Two side sleeves are expandable. They hold your leg guards perfectly.
- Three mesh compartments let air flow. This keeps your gear from getting smelly.
- Two shelves inside can be moved. They help you organize your stuff.
- Two bat sleeves are fully lined. Your bats are protected.
- A strap on the outside holds your glove or helmet. It has a quick-release buckle for easy access.
- An inside mesh pocket with Velcro is great for batting gloves.
- A small bag inside is removable. You can keep your personal items separate.
- A soft, felt-lined pocket is also there for your phone or keys.
- The inline wheels are tough. They roll smoothly over different surfaces.
- The bag is big, measuring 28.5”L x 16”W x 12”D. It fits a lot of gear.

The Ultimate Guide to Choosing a Wheeled Catcher’s Bag
As a catcher, you carry a lot of gear. Your helmet, mask, chest protector, leg guards, and extra gloves all need a home. A wheeled catcher’s bag makes transporting all this equipment much easier. Instead of lugging everything, you can simply roll it to and from the field. This guide will help you pick the best wheeled bag for your needs.
What to Look For: Key Features of a Great Bag
When you’re shopping for a wheeled catcher’s bag, keep these important features in mind:
- Size and Capacity: How much gear do you have? Bigger players or those with more equipment will need a larger bag. Look at the dimensions to make sure everything fits comfortably.
- Wheels: Sturdy, smooth-rolling wheels are essential. Some bags have large, rugged wheels for all terrains, while others have smaller, more maneuverable wheels.
- Compartments and Organization: Good bags have separate pockets for different gear. This keeps your equipment organized and prevents damage. Look for padded compartments for your helmet and other delicate items.
- Durability: You want a bag that can withstand the rigors of baseball or softball season. Strong zippers, reinforced stitching, and tough materials are signs of a well-made bag.
- Handle: A comfortable, telescoping handle that extends to a good height will make pulling your bag much easier.
- Extra Pockets: Many bags include extra pockets for smaller items like batting gloves, sunglasses, or a water bottle.
Important Materials: What Your Bag is Made Of
The materials used in a catcher’s bag play a big role in its durability and performance.
- Nylon: This is a very common and strong material. It’s water-resistant and can handle a lot of wear and tear.
- Polyester: Similar to nylon, polyester is durable and resistant to stretching and shrinking.
- Canvas: Canvas is a thick, sturdy fabric. It’s very tough but can be heavier than nylon or polyester.
- PVC Coating: Some bags have a PVC coating on the inside or outside to make them more waterproof and easier to clean.
Factors That Affect Quality: What Makes a Bag Good or Bad
Several things can make a catcher’s bag better or worse.
Factors That Improve Quality:
- Reinforced Stitching: Extra strong threads at stress points prevent seams from splitting.
- Heavy-Duty Zippers: Zippers that are thick and smooth to open and close will last longer.
- Padded Compartments: These protect your helmet and other gear from bumps and scratches.
- Water-Resistant Fabric: This keeps your gear dry, especially important for gloves and uniforms.
- Sturdy Wheel Axles: The metal rod that the wheels attach to should be strong.
Factors That Reduce Quality:
- Thin, Flimsy Fabric: This can tear easily.
- Cheap Zippers: Zippers that snag or break quickly are frustrating.
- Weak Stitching: Seams that come apart after a few uses are a sign of poor quality.
- Small, Hard Wheels: These can be difficult to roll over grass or uneven surfaces.
- Lack of Padding: Your equipment won’t be as protected.
